They could trade him back, just couldnt retain more salary.

Not that it would ever happen but it could if we moved money out.

"A team cannot reacquire a player whom they have retained salary from for a minimum of one year after the date of the transaction, or unless the player's contract expires or is terminated prior to the one-year date" Source

So they can't reacquire him this season unless LA terminates his contract. GMJR could sign him this off season though, since he'll be UFA.
